Abstract

In this paper, we evaluated and compared the UDP and TCP performance analysis of integration of Hierarchical Mobile IP protocol and Mobile IP protocol with an integration of Cellular IP and Mobile IP protocols. The performance of integration of micro and macro mobility protocols are compared using factors such as UDP packet loss and TCP throughput that occur due to handoff are presented. We aim to provide a lightweight efficient solution suitable for local access to mobile stations in limited size cell systems with possible high internal handoff rates.The simulation results are presented using the network simulator ns2. It is observed from the results that the integration of cellular IP with Mobile IP protocol gives better performance when compared to the integration of Mobile IP with Hierarchical Mobile IP protocol.
